There are always two sides of any trades and in a lot of instances there are more but for the purposes of this article I will only write about the two sides of this trade. In general, you can either “go long” which means you buy now and wait for the price to go up and sell at a profit or you “go short” which means you purchase shorts and expect the price of oil to go down. Personally I would go long in this scenario but that is only me. The nature of the stock market is to go up and down. It is constantly in a state of flux.
